Just right now i got a notification that my sd card is damaged... i tried taking it out and all that but to no avail... help?? i really dont wanna reformat it...
You might try putting it in an adapter and plugging it directly in to your computer. That might enable you to get one more read off of it so you can back up the data. You could then try to format it, and move your data back on to it.
IF you are able to format the card don't expect that to be a permanent fix. If the card is truly damaged in some way then it's going to fail again - formatted or not.
I haven't used one in a long time, but I would probably look into an app (for your PC) that's used to try to recover data on a damaged SD card. Get a card reader that works with micro-SD and get one of these apps. (Google for one, or perhaps others have recent experience.) I believe that good ones are non-destructive - they will recover what they can and then allow you to format the card.
